Located right across from Klyde Warren Park in the heart of Dallas, Miriam Cocina Latina blends modern Mexican cuisine with a bright, inviting vibe. Just a short stroll from some of the city’s most popular concert venues, it’s a lively spot with a stylish interior, colorful cocktails, and bold flavors that set the tone for a fun night out. Whether you're craving tacos, enchiladas, or a top-shelf margarita, this restaurant delivers with flair.
Location is everything—and Miriam Cocina Latina is ideally situated for a quick bite before or after a show. The service is known for being fast and attentive, so you won’t be late to your seat. With a bustling yet relaxed atmosphere, it’s easy to enjoy conversation without shouting. The menu offers a wide variety of dishes that are both hearty and shareable, perfect for fueling up before a night of music.
Guests rave about the fresh ingredients and creative takes on Mexican classics. The guacamole and margaritas are especially popular, and many reviewers note the welcoming service and great park views. The lively decor and open layout make it a fun, social place to gather before the show.
Because of its popularity and prime location, it can get busy during peak hours—reservations are recommended if you're on a tight schedule. Some visitors mention that parking can be tricky, so consider rideshare if you're headed to a concert.
Miriam Cocina Latina offers a flavorful, festive, and convenient dining experience that sets the perfect tone for a night of live music in Dallas.
